Feynman Tree Theorem and the Gelfand--Yaglom Formula

High Energy Physics - Theory 2026-07-27 v1

Abstract

The Gelfand--Yaglom formula equates the one-loop determinant of a Schr\"odinger operator with Dirichlet boundary conditions to the solution of an initial value problem. Following a suggestion by Polyakov, we provide a new diagrammatic proof of this formula as a direct application of the Feynman Tree Theorem. By cutting the one-loop determinant, we re-express it as a sum of tree diagrams. These trees explicitly encode the solution to the Gelfand--Yaglom initial value problem. We extend this diagrammatic framework to general boundary conditions and comment on a potential generalization to quantum field theory.
